zeilenabstand

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• zeilenabstand

    Frage:

    ich habe jetzt ein formularfeld wo ein Newsinhalt rein geschrieben wird und dann später auf der seite angezeigt wird.

    aber wenn ich jetzt nen zeilenabstand mache also (enter) bzw.:

    PHP-Code:

    <class="Stil6">Text Text Text Text</p>

    <
    class="Stil6">Text Text Text Text</p
    wie bekomm ich es dann hin das er diese

    PHP-Code:
    <class="Stil6"></p
    die vor und nach jedem "enter" mit gespeichert werden müssen mit speichert in der mysqldb?

  • #2
    wird doch automatisch gemacht, mit \r\n zum beispiel. vielleicht suchst du auch nl2br.

    peter
    Nukular, das Wort ist N-u-k-u-l-a-r (Homer Simpson)
    Meine Seite

    Kommentar


    • #3
      Vielleicht solltest du aber auch mal konkret beschreiben, was du wirklich tust. Der PHP-Code wäre hier interessant.

      So ein Quatsch wie Stil6 sieht mir ja sehr nach Dreamweaver aus.

      Kommentar


      • #4
        Ja, genau, ist Dreamweaver

        also der code ... da ich hier keine 2.000 zeilen posten möchte such ich mal die wichtigsten sachen raus.

        also ich habe eine textarea: ( und ja mir ist aufgefallen das die variable maxlength="5000" da nicht funktioniert )

        PHP-Code:
        .<textarea name="news" cols="59" rows="20" id="news" maxlength="5000">' . $news . '</textarea
        dann hol ich mir den inhalt:

        PHP-Code:
        $news $_POST['news']; 
        dann speicher ich den in der DB:

        PHP-Code:
        mysql_select_dbMYSQL_DATENBANK ) or die("Auswahl der Datenbank fehlgeschlagen");
        $sql "INSERT INTO `news`

        (..., `news` ,...)
        VALUES
        (..., '
        $news',...);";

        $db_erg mysql_query($sql) or die("Auswahl der Datenbank fehlgeschlagen"); 
        So das war der speichervorgang ...

        jetzt hol ich die sachen wieder raus:

        PHP-Code:

        $id 
        $_GET['id'];

        mysql_select_dbMYSQL_DATENBANK ) or die("Auswahl der Datenbank fehlgeschlagen");
        $news_sql "SELECT titel FROM news WHERE id='$id'";
        $news_result mysql_query($news_sql) or die('Fehler 3: '.mysql_error());
        while (
        $row mysql_fetch_array($news_resultMYSQL_NUM)){
        $news[] = $row[0]; 
        und lasse die daten anzeigen:

        PHP-Code:
        <div align="left"><class="Stil6">' . $news[0] . '</p
        jetzt wird aber aus

        Zeilenabstand

        Zeilenabstand

        Zeilenabstand

        Zeilenabstand

        = Zeilenabstand Zeilenabstand Zeilenabstand Zeilenabstand
        Zuletzt geändert von owi; 09.09.2008, 05:38.

        Kommentar


        • #5
          ahhh lol hab herausgefunden was mit nl2br gemeint ist lol ^^

          PHP-Code:
          <div align="left"><class="Stil6">' . nl2br($news[0]) . '</p
          erstmal danke !

          ABER

          jetzt kommt nen anderes Problem ^^

          ich habe in diesem text ($news[0] ) noch einen CODE eingebaut.


          PHP-Code:
          <div align="center">
          <
          script type="text/javascript">
          <!--
          google_ad_client "pub-8722586294278059";
          /* 468x60, Erstellt 06.04.08 */
          google_ad_slot "4212572441";
          google_ad_width 468;
          google_ad_height 60;
          //-->
          </script>
          <
          script type="text/javascript" src="http://pagead2.googlesyndication.com/pagead/show_ads.js">
          </
          script>
          </
          div
          Jetzt wird der Text zwar perfekt angezeigt aber der Code nicht und es kommen lauter fehler wenn ich die Seite aufrufe -.-
          Zuletzt geändert von owi; 09.09.2008, 05:39.

          Kommentar


          • #6
            mh...

            wenn ich den code in einer variable speicher:


            PHP-Code:
            $werbung '<div align="center">
            <script type="text/javascript">
            <!--
            google_ad_client = "pub-8722586294278059";
            /* 468x60, Erstellt 06.04.08 */
            google_ad_slot = "4212572441";
            google_ad_width = 468;
            google_ad_height = 60;
            //-->
            </script>
            <script type="text/javascript" src="http://pagead2.googlesyndication.com/pagead/show_ads.js">
            </script>
            </div>'

            und dann den text in der mysql datenbank so speicher ...

            PHP-Code:
            TEXT' . $werbung . 'TEXT 
            funktioniert leider auch nicht =(

            Kommentar


            • #7
              Funktioniert nicht, ist keine Fehlerbeschreibung!

              aber der Code nicht und es kommen lauter fehler wenn ich die Seite aufrufe -.-
              Muss man dir alles aus der Nase ziehen?

              Kommentar

              Lädt...
              X